Sunteți pe pagina 1din 8

1 - 10 PRINT “Hello World!

2 - 10 CLS
20 INPUT "What's your name?"; A
30 Let B = "Hello"
40 PRINT B+" "+A

3 - 10 CLS
20 INPUT "What is your name?"; A
30 IF A = "Alice" OR A = "Bob" THEN PRINT "Hello"+" "+A ELSE PRINT "No"

4 - 10 CLS
20 INPUT "Type a Number"; N
30 FOR A=1 TON
40 LET X= A+X
50 NEXT A
60 PRINT X
5 - 10 CLS
15 REM This program adds the sum of 1 and a number the user picks that is a multiple of 3 or
5.
20 INPUT "Type in a number"; N
30 IF N = 3 OR N = 5 OR N =6 OR N = 9 OR N = 10 OR N = 12 OR N = 15 THEN PRINT 1 + N
ELSE PRINT 1 + 0
6 - 10 CLS
15 REM This program asks the user for a number n and gives them the possibility to choose
between computing the sum and computing the product of 1 and n.
20 INPUT "Type in a number"; N
30 INPUT "Compute the sum or compute the product?"; A
40 IF A = "Sum" THEN PRINT 1 + N ELSE GOTO 60
50 END
60 IF A = "Product" THEN PRINT 1 * N ELSE GOTO 10

7- 10
CLS
15 REM
This

program prints a multiplication table for numbers up to 12


20 PRINT "0 1 2 3 4 5 6 7 8 9 10 11 12"
30 PRINT "1 1 2 3 4 5 6 7 8 9 10 11 12"
40 PRINT "2 2 4 6 8 10 12 14 16 18 20 22 24"
50 PRINT "3 3 6 9 12 15 18 21 24 27 30 33 36"
60 PRINT "4 4 8 12 16 20 24 28 32 36 40 44 48"
70 PRINT "5 5 10 15 20 25 30 35 40 45 50 55 60"
80 PRINT "6 6 12 18 24 30 36 42 48 54 60 66 72"
90 PRINT "7 7 14 21 28 35 42 49 56 63 70 77 84"
100 PRINT "8 8 16 24 32 40 48 56 64 72 80 88 96"
110 PRINT "9 9 18 27 36 45 54 63 72 81 90 99 108"
120 PRINT "10 10 20 30 40 50 60 70 80 90 100 110 120"
130 PRINT "11 11 22 33 44 55 66 77 88 99 110 121 132"
140 PRINT "12 12 24 36 48 60 72 84 96 108 120 132 144"
8 - 10 CLS
15 REM This program finds all of the prime numbers infinitely
20 LET L = PI
30 ARRAY N
40 FOR I = 1 TO L
50 LET N[I] = I
60 NEXT I
70 LET P = 2
80 PRINT P;" ";
90 FOR I = P TO L STEP P
100 LET N[I] = 0
110 NEXT I
120 LET P = P + 1
130 IF P = L THEN END ELSE GOTO 140
140 IF N[P] <> 0 THEN GOTO 80 ELSE GOTO 120
9 - 10 CLS
20 REM
30 ARRAY C
40 LET C[1] = 0
50 LET C[2] = 0
60 LET C[4] = 0
70 LET C[5] = 0
80 LET C[6] = 0
90 LET C[7] = 0
100 LET C[8] = 0
110 LET C[9] = 0
120 LET C[10] = 0
170 LET F = 0
200 LET A = ROUND(RAND(10))
250 CLS
300 INPUT "Guess That Number!!!! (Between 1 - 10)"; B
400 IF B = A THEN GOTO 900 ELSE GOTO 500
500 IF B > A THEN PRINT "Your Number Is Too Big!!!" ELSE GOTO 700
550 IF B = C[1] OR B = C[2] OR B = C[3] OR B = C[4] OR B = C[5] OR B = C[6] OR B = C[7]
OR B = C[8] OR B = C[9] OR B = C[10] THEN GOTO 680 ELSE GOTO 580
580 IF B = 2 THEN LET C[2] = 2 ELSE GOTO 740
590 IF B = 1 THEN LET C[1] = 1 ELSE GOTO 741
600 IF B = 4 THEN LET C[4] = 4 ELSE GOTO 610
610 IF B = 5 THEN LET C[5] = 5 ELSE GOTO 620
620 IF B = 6 THEN LET C[6] = 6 ELSE GOTO 630
630 IF B = 7 THEN LET C[7] = 7 ELSE GOTO 640
640 IF B = 8 THEN LET C[8] = 8 ELSE GOTO 650
650 IF B = 9 THEN LET C[9] = 9 ELSE GOTO 660
660 IF B = 10 THEN LET C[10] = 10 ELSE GOTO 680
670 LET F = F + 1
680 PAUSE 1000
690 GOTO 250
700 IF B < A THEN PRINT "Your Number Is Too Small!!!" ELSE GOTO 400
710 IF B = C[1] OR B = C[2] OR B = C[3] OR B = C[4] OR B = C[5] OR B = C[6] OR B = C[7]
OR B = C[8] OR B = C[9] OR B = C[10] THEN GOTO 760 ELSE GOTO 730
730 IF B = 2 THEN LET C[2] = 2 ELSE GOTO 740
740 IF B = 1 THEN LET C[1] = 1 ELSE GOTO 741
741 IF B = 4 THEN LET C[4] = 4 ELSE GOTO 742
742 IF B = 5 THEN LET C[5] = 5 ELSE GOTO 743
743 IF B = 6 THEN LET C[6] = 6 ELSE GOTO 744
744 IF B = 7 THEN LET C[7] = 7 ELSE GOTO 745
745 IF B = 8 THEN LET C[8] = 8 ELSE GOTO 746
746 IF B = 9 THEN LET C[9] = 9 ELSE GOTO 747
747 IF B = 10 THEN LET C[10] = 10 ELSE GOTO 748
748 IF B = 3 THEN LET C[3] = 3 ELSE GOTO 760
750 LET F = F + 1
760 PAUSE 1000
800 GOTO 250
900 PRINT "Wow, You Guessed it!!!"
1000 PRINT " "
1100 PRINT "You Failed " + F + " Times!!!"
10 - 10 CLS
15 REM This program
prints out the next 20
leap years
20 LET Y = 2016
30 LET Y = Y + 4
35 PAUSE 50
40 IF Y < 2097 THEN
PRINT Y ELSE END
50 GOTO 30

S-ar putea să vă placă și